About The Position

The Interior Designer works closely with the project's design team from concept to completion. In collaboration with the Project Team, the Interior Designer is responsible for client presentations, and the production of complete, accurate and well-coordinated documents that are in accordance with The Johnson Studio at Cooper Carry standards to be on time and budget. The Interior Designer works on complex projects and often multiple projects simultaneously.
